I just had to go pick up my mustang from the shop and on the way back I was folowling my truck(2002 f250 Mbrp 4" exhaust) and it sounded like a lawnmower with the blades spinning. It only sounded like this during slow acceleration. During harder acceleration it would get drowned out by the normal diesel rumble. Could I possibly have an exhaust leak at the turbo?
Are you trying to describe a large fan sound like a lawnmower makes when the blades are spinning?
If so, it sounds like your clutch fan is locked, either from normal operation because it's hot out and you are using your AC, or it's malfunctioned and siezed on the shaft.

I have AFE stage 2 intake but no straight pipe exhaust, and yes that is what is sounded like kwik, where and how would I check to see if the clutch fan was siezed to shaft. AC was not on.
truck "NOT" running grab fan and give it a spin..it should move with very little resistant..also give it a wiggle make sure there is no play in the bearing..
